The Jinggangshan (simplified Chinese: 井冈山; traditional Chinese: 井岡山; pinyin: Jǐnggāngshān) was the first passenger car produced by the Chinese automobile manufacturer Beijing Automobile Works (BAW) and sold under the Jinggangshan brand from 1958 to 1960.
